What is Mineralys Therapeutics, Inc.'s capex?
Mineralys Therapeutics, Inc. (MLYS) reported capex of $15K in Q4 2025.
What does capex mean?
Cash spent on property, plant, and equipment — the primary measure of investment in productive capacity and infrastructure.
